Let's dive into some creative ideas to make your dorm room the ultimate hangout spot!1. Embrace a Minimalist AestheticWhen it comes to dorm room decor, less is often more. A minimalist approach not only makes the space look cleaner but also provides a sense of calm. Choose a neutral color palette and incorporate a few statement pieces, such as a bold rug or unique wall art, to keep things interesting.2. Personalize with Wall ArtYour walls are the perfect canvas to showcase your interests. Consider hanging up posters of your favorite bands, movies, or sports teams. Alternatively, you can create a gallery wall with framed photos of friends and family, or even your own artwork!3. Smart Storage SolutionsIn a small dorm room, maximizing storage is crucial. Invest in multifunctional furniture, such as ottomans that open up for storage or a bed with built-in drawers. Use shelves to display books and decor while keeping your space organized.4. Create a Cozy Study NookMake your study area inviting by adding a comfortable chair and stylish desk lamp. Personalize your workspace with a corkboard or whiteboard for reminders and inspiration. Keeping your study nook organized will help you focus on your studies.5. Lighting MattersGood lighting can transform your dorm room from drab to fab. Use string lights or stylish lamps to create a warm ambiance. Consider installing a dimmer switch for flexibility, allowing you to adjust the mood for studying or relaxing.6. Add GreeneryPlants can liven up any space! Choose low-maintenance options like succulents or snake plants that can thrive indoors without too much care. They not only enhance your decor but also improve air quality.7. Make it ComfortableYour dorm room should feel like a sanctuary. Invest in quality bedding and pillows that reflect your style. A cozy throw blanket can add a touch of warmth and comfort to your space.FAQQ: How can I make my dorm room feel more spacious?A: Use mirrors to reflect light and create an illusion of more space.
